Maine Revised Statutes
Me. Rev. Stat. tit. 17-A, § 3 (2026)
All crimes defined by statute; civil actions

1.
No conduct constitutes a crime unless it is prohibited
A.
By this code; or
[PL 1975, c. 499, §1 (NEW).]
B.
By any statute or private act outside this code, including any rule, regulation or ordinance authorized by and lawfully adopted under a statute.
[PL 1977, c. 510, §13 (AMD).]
[PL 1977, c. 510, §13 (AMD).]
2.
This code does not bar, suspend, or otherwise affect any right or liability for damages, penalty, forfeiture or other remedy authorized by law to be recovered or enforced in a civil action, regardless of whether the conduct involved in such civil action constitutes an offense defined in this code.
[PL 1975, c. 499, §1 (NEW).]
SECTION HISTORY
PL 1975, c. 499, §1 (NEW). PL 1975, c. 740, §12 (AMD). PL 1977, c. 510, §13 (AMD).
